An Enhanced PSO-Based Clustering Energy Optimization Algorithm for Wireless Sensor Network
Table 2
Comparison of simulation results of proposed PSO-based clustering algorithm and competitive clustering algorithm.
| Number of rounds | 50 | 100 | 150 | 200 |
| Overall residual energy (J) | CC | 292.75 | 288.13 | 284.73 | 281.94 | PSO-based | 294.52 | 291.75 | 289.54 | 287.5 |
| Average energy consumption (J) | CC | 0.04 | 0.09 | 0.12 | 0.15 | PSO-based | 0.02 | 0.05 | 0.08 | 0.1 |
| Average residual energy (J) | CC | 2.96 | 2.91 | 2.88 | 2.85 | PSO-based | 2.97 | 2.95 | 2.92 | 2.9 |
| Relative energy in (l/pkt) | CC | 0.04 | 0.01 | 0.01 | 0.01 | PSO-based | 0.02 | 0.01 | 0.01 | 0.01 |
| Total energy consumption (J) | CC | 4.25 | 8.87 | 12.27 | 15.06 | PSO-based | 2.47 | 5.23 | 7.44 | 9.48 |
| Lifetime (s) | CC | 13983.80 | 6697.76 | 4842.70 | 3944.72 | PSO-based | 24252.1 | 11393 | 7998.28 | 6273.96 |
